Which best describes the range of the function f(x) = 2 after it has been reflected over the y-axis?

The graph of f(x) = 2 is just a horizontal line that crosses the y axis at (0, 2).

After reflecting this graph on the y axis, it will look no different.

The range would be f(x) = 2, as that is the only value of y.
